1.Discovery and investigation of six polio vaccine derived viruses in Guangzhou City
Min CUI ; Chunhuan ZHANG ; Wei ZHANG ; Jun LIU ; Jialing LI ; Jianxiong XU ; Wenji WANG ; Qing HE ; Lihong NI ; Xuexia YUN ; Huanying ZHENG
Journal of Public Health and Preventive Medicine 2025;36(2):22-25
Objective To understand the surveillance situation of poliovirus in Guangzhou from 2011 to 2024, and to further strengthen polio surveillance and ensure the continued maintenance of a polio-free status. Methods An analysis was conducted on the discovery and investigation results of six cases of vaccine-derived poliovirus (VDPV) detected in Guangzhou. Results A total of 6 VDPV incidents were reported in Guangzhou from 2011 to June 2024, among which 5 incidents were from sewage sample testing in the Liede Sewage Treatment Plant in Guangzhou, all of which were confirmed as VDPV, with 1 for type I, 1 for type II, and 3 for type III. In addition, one confirmed HFMD case was identified as a type VDPV II carrier. No presence of any wild poliovirus (WPV), VDPV cases, or circulating VDPV (cVDPV) was reported. Conclusion Guangzhou City has maintained a high level of vigilance and effectiveness in the monitoring and prevention of polio. Continuously strengthening the construction of the polio monitoring network, optimizing vaccination strategies, and comprehensively improving public health awareness are still the focus of the prevention and control work in the future.
2.Research progress in action mechanism of small molecular compounds targeting Wnt signaling pathway against osteosarcoma
Xue ZHANG ; Jialing LIU ; Shuang LIU
Chinese Journal of Pharmacology and Toxicology 2024;38(9):694-700
Osteosarcoma is the most common primary malignant bone tumor in children and adoles-cents.The current treatment methods include immunotherapy,gene therapy,targeted therapy and chemotherapy,but the prognosis is poor and prone to recurrence and metastasis.There is increasing evidence that the Wnt signaling pathway is involved in the entire process of osteosarcoma occurrence,development,metastasis,and prognosis,making it an attractive target.Current research on small molecule compounds related to the Wnt signaling pathway is making progress and attracting more attention so that targeting the Wnt signaling pathway with small molecule compounds has become a promising therapeutic strategy for osteosarcoma.This review focused on the Wnt signaling pathway and introduced the relationship between the Wnt signaling pathway and osteosarcoma,targeting small molecule compounds upstream and downstream of Wnt signaling,analyzed the classification and mechanism of action of related small molecule compounds,and summarized research progress.Target-ing the Wnt signaling pathway,clarifying the specific mechanism,and an intimate knowledge of the complexity of Wnt signaling will help improve the formulation of clinical treatment plans for osteosarcoma,providing references and ideas for the development of anti-tumor drugs related to Wnt regulation.
3.Distribution and antimicrobial resistance of bacterial strains isolated from blood samples in a traditional Chinese medicine hospital in Shenzhen
Xutao ZHENG ; Rimei ZHANG ; Qiong DUAN ; Shanru LIN ; Jialing TANG ; Lingfan YIN
Chinese Journal of Infection and Chemotherapy 2024;24(4):442-447
Objective To investigate the distribution and antimicrobial resistance of the bacterial strains isolated from blood samples of inpatients in Longgang Hospital,Beijing University of Chinese Medicine.Methods The bacterial identification and antimicrobial susceptibility test results for the strains isolated from 2018 to 2022 were retrospectively analyzed.Results A total of 910 strains of bacteria were isolated from blood samples,of which 63.2%(575/910)were gram-negative bacteria and 36.8%(335/910)were gram-positive bacteria.Escherichia coli,coagulase-negative Staphylococcus,Klebsiella pneumoniae,Staphylococcus aureus,and Enterococcus spp.were the top 5 pathogens.In the past 5 years,no carbapenem-resistant strains of E.coli or K.pneumoniae were found in the blood samples of the inpatients.A.baumannii had a resistance rate of 11.8%to carbapenems.The prevalence of methicillin-resistant strains in S.aureus,S.epidermidis and other Staphylococcus species was 16.7%,75.0%and 55.5%,respectively.No vancomycin-or linezolid-resistant staphylococcual isolates were found.No strains of Enterococcus faecalis or Enterococcus faecium were found resistant to high concentrations of gentamicin,linezolid,or vancomycin.Conclusions The bacteria isolated from blood samples in Longgang Hospital were mainly gram-negative bacteria.Carbapenem-resistant strain was identified in the strains of A.baumannii.Bacterial resistance surveillance should be strengthened for the isolates from blood samples and other specimens from the site of infection.Antimicrobial agents should be used rationally to prevent the spread of drug-resistant bacteria.
4.Risk factors and survival analysis for multi-drug resistant organism infections in recipients of simultaneous pancreas-kidney transplantation
Rongxin CHEN ; Luhao LIU ; Jiali FANG ; Guanghui LI ; Lu XU ; Peng ZHANG ; Wei YIN ; Jialing WU ; Junjie MA ; Zheng CHEN
Chinese Journal of Organ Transplantation 2024;45(7):468-475
Objective:To summarize the distributional characteristics of postoperative occurrence of multi-drug resistant organism (MDRO) infections and their risk factors in simultaneous pancreas-kidney transplantation (SPK) recipients and examine the impact of MDRO infections on the survival of SPK recipients.Method:From January 2016 to December 2022, the relevant clinical data were retrospectively reviewed for 218 SPK recipients. The source of donor-recipient specimens and the composition percentage of MDRO pathogens were examined. According to whether or not MDRO infection occurred post-transplantation, they were assigned into two groups of MDRO (98 cases) and non-MDRO (120 cases). The clinical data of two groups of donors and recipients were analyzed. And the risk factors for an onset of MDRO infection were examined by binary Logistic regression. The survival rate of two recipient groups was compared by Kaplan-Meier method.Result:A total of 98/218 recipients (45%) developed MDRO infections. And 46 (46.9%) of sputum and 34 (34.7%) of urine were cultured positively and 49 (50%) pathogens expressed extended spectrum beta-lactamase. There were pneumonia (46 cases, 46.9%), urinary tract infections (34 cases, 34.7%), abdominal infections (16 cases, 16.3%) and bloodstream infections (2 cases, 2.0%). Univariate regression analysis revealed that length of renal failure ( P=0.037), length of hospitalization ( P<0.001), length of antibiotic use ( P<0.001), novel antibiotics ( P=0.014), albumin ( P<0.001) and leukocyte count ( P<0.001) were risk factors for an onset of MDRO infections. The results of multifactorial regression indicated that low albumin ( OR=0.855, 95% CI: 0.790~0.925, P<0.001) and leukopenia ( OR=0.656, 95% CI: 0.550~0.783, P<0.001) were independent risk factors for an onset of MDRO infections. The survival rates of recipients in MDRO group at Year 1/3 post-operation were 92.9% (91/98) and 89.8% (88/98). And the survival rate of recipients in non-MDRO group was 96.7% (116/120) at Year 1/3 post-operation. Inter-group difference was not statistically significant in 1-year survival rate of two recipient groups ( P=0.201); statistically significant inter-group difference in 3-year survival rate between two recipient groups ( P=0.041) . Conclusion:Low albumin and leukopenia are risk factors for MDRO infection. Infection with MDRO has some impact on the survival of recipients.
5.Study on Rapid Identification Method of Hedysari Radix Medicinal Materials Based on Intelligent Sensory and Multivariate Statistical Analysis
Juanjuan LIU ; Huaqian GONG ; Sini LI ; Jialing ZHANG ; Yiyang CHEN ; Huifang HU ; Xiaohui MA ; Ling JIN
Chinese Journal of Information on Traditional Chinese Medicine 2024;31(10):129-134
Objective To establish the rapid identification method of Hedysari Radix wild and cultivated products by integrating the identification characteristics of TCM traits obtained by intelligent senses such as electronic nose and colorimeter based on the multivariate statistical analysis method;To provide new ideas and methods for the formulation of commodity specification standards and the application research of market quality control for Hedysari Radix.Methods Totally 29 batches of samples of Hedysari Radix were detected based on colorimeter and electronic nose technology to obtain their sensory information,and the effective components of Hedysari Radix were determined by high performance liquid chromatography(HPLC)and other methods for joint analysis.After establishing the optimal experimental conditions of Hedysari Radix electronic nose,multivariate statistical analysis methods,such as principal component analysis(PCA),orthogonal partial least squares-discriminant analysis(OPLS-DA)and clustering analysis,were used to establish the identification model of Hedysari Radix wild and cultivated commodities.Results The optimum test conditions of Hedysari Radix electronic nose(particle size of 65 mesh):the sample weight was 2.0 g,the optimum temperature of the sample was 50℃,and the time was 25 min.A single intelligent sensory result could not quickly and accurately identify the two,but the fusion information could quickly identify the wild and cultivated commodities of Hedysari Radix,and the chemical composition had a certain correlation with the color and taste.Conclusion Electronic nose and colorimeter can quickly and accurately distinguish wild and cultivated Hedysari Radix after multivariate statistical analysis,which is simple and feasible.The combined analysis of its related properties and active components can be used for the quality evaluation of Hedysari Radix.
6.Adolescent female reproductive system dysplasia: a clinical study of 356 cases
Jialing XU ; Yaping WANG ; Xi ZHANG ; Wu LIU ; Xiufeng HUANG ; Juanqing LI
Chinese Journal of Obstetrics and Gynecology 2024;59(5):360-367
Objective:To explore the age of onset and consultation, the main clinical manifestations, common types of combined malformations, the relationship of endometriosis, surgical prognosis and different types of proportion of adolescent female reproductive system dysplasia.Methods:The medical records of 356 patients (aged 10-19) with female reproductive system dysplasia in Women′s Hospital, School of Medicine, Zhejiang University from January 2003 to August 2018 were collected and retrospectively analyzed.Results:(1) Among the 356 adolescent dysplasia patients, uterine dysplasia (23.6%, 84/356), oblique vaginal septum syndrome (OVSS; 22.5%, 80/356) and vaginal dysplasia (21.6%, 77/356) were the most frequent ones, followed by multi-sectional dysplasia (16.0%, 57/356), other types of developmental abnormalities like external genitaliaand urogenital fistula (13.5%, 48/356) and Mayer-Rokitansky-Küster-Hauser syndrome (MRKH syndrome; 2.8%, 10/356). (2) There were significant differences between the median age of onset and the age of consultation of patients with OVSS and other types of abnormalities except hymen atresia (both P<0.05). In contrast, there were no significant differences between the age of onset and the age of consultation of the patients of uterine dysplasia, vaginal dysplasia, hymen atresia, MRKH syndrome and multi-sectional dysplasia (all P>0.05). (3) The clinical manifestations were lack of specificity, and mainly abnormal finding was lower abdominal pain. (4) After admission, the majority of patients underwent comprehensive cardiopulmonary examination (71.3%, 254/356) and urinary system examination (63.5%, 226/356). Only 18.3% (65/356) of patients had completed abdominal organ examination, and 5.9% (21/356) skeletal system examination. About other systemic malformations, urological malformations were the most common (27.5%, 98/356), followed by anorectal malformation (0.6%, 2/356), heart malformations (0.3%, 1/356), and spinal malformations (0.3%, 1/356). 46.4% (84/181) of the surgical patients were diagnosed with combined endometriosis. Patients with obstructive genital tract malformations were more likely to combine with endometriosis than non-obstructive ones [50.3% (74/147) vs 29.4% (10/34); P<0.05]. However, there was no significant difference between the severity of endometriosis of those two kinds ( P>0.05). (5) Totally 308 patients were followed up successfully with a median of 25.0 years old, and 20 cases were treated again; 12.0% (37/308) of them were suffering from menstrual disorder and 33.1% (102/308) of them with dysmenorrhea. Totally 130 patients had sexually active reported no sexual problems. Conclusions:Uterine dysplasia, OVSS and vaginal dysplasia are the most common syndromes in adolescent female reproductive system dysplasia along with frequent cases of coexisting urinary malformations and increasing risks of endometriosis. Meanwhile, the lack of specificity of clinical manifestations might delay the timely diagnosis and treatment after the onset of symptoms. Nonetheless, most patients could achieve good surgical outcomes.
7.Epidemiological characteristics of scrub typhus in Lianyungang City in 2010-2022
Yanze ZHENG ; Yuge CHEN ; Jialing ZHANG ; Furong LYU ; Ming ZHI ; Haipeng LI ; Xing ZHAO ; Anlian ZHOU ; Lei XU
Journal of Public Health and Preventive Medicine 2024;35(3):95-98
Objective To understand the epidemiological characteristics of scrub typhus disease and to provide a scientific basis for the prevention and control of scrub typhus disease. Methods Descriptive epidemiological methods were used to analyze the population and regional distribution of scrub typhus. Seasonal characteristics were analyzed using concentration method and circular distribution method, and incidence trend was analyzed using joinpoint regression model. Results The annual incidence rate of scrub typhus was 0.95/100 000 from 2010 to 2022. The incidence rate of male was 0.77/100 000, lower than that of female 1.12/100 000 (χ2=18.89, P<0.05). The incidence rate of the 60-74 years old group was 3.38/100,000, and the total number of cases in the age group 45-74 years was 416 (74.95%). Occupational distribution was mainly among farmers, with 448 cases (80.72%). The top three regions with the highest number of reported cases (in order: Donghai County, Ganyu District, and Guannan County) reported a total of 416 cases, accounting for 74.95%. Concentration ratio was M=0.9408, and the incidence of scrub typhus disease was strictly seasonal. Circular distribution results showed a-=-62.3728, S=20.8960. The circular distribution results indicated that the peak day was October 19th, and the peak period was between October 7 to December 19. The average annual percentage change (AAPC) of the incidence rate from 2010 to 2022 was 13.70%, 95% CI (-8.62%~41.48%), and the incidence rate showed an upward trend (t=1.15, P=0.249). Conclusion The incidence of scrub typhus disease is strictly seasonal, and the incidence rate over the years shows an upward trend. It is necessary to strengthen monitoring and take various intervention measures to reduce the risk of scrub typhus disease.
8.microRNA-26a inhibits extracellular matrix synthesis in high glucose-induced renal tubular epithelial cells by regulating ferroptosis
Xingyue LI ; Yunyang QIAO ; Hui ZHENG ; Jialing JI ; Aiqing ZHANG
Acta Universitatis Medicinalis Anhui 2024;59(2):254-259
Objective To investigate the effect and possible mechanism of microRNA-26a(miR-26a)on the syn-thesis of extracellular matrix(ECM)induced by high glucose(HG)in renal tubular epithelial cells(RTECs).Methods A model of diabetic kidney disease(DKD)was constructed by inducing RTECs with HG.MiR-26a was overexpressed in HG-induced RTECs,and RT-qPCR and Western blot were used to assess the effects of miR-26a on ECM synthesis and ferroptosis-related markers in HG-treated RTECs.Ferrostatin(Fer-1)was used to inhibit ferroptosis in the DKD model,and its impact on ECM synthesis was evaluated.RT-qPCR and Western blot were performed to measure ferroptosis-related markers,and fluorescence microscopy was used to observe the intensity of reactive oxygen species(ROS).Results Compared with the control group,the expression of miR-26a decreased in HG-treated cells,while the expression levels of ECM synthesis-related indexes fibronectin and collagen Ⅰ in-creased.After overexpressing miR-26a,the HG+miR-26a group showed a significant increase in miR-26a expres-sion and a decrease in fibronectin and collagen Ⅰ expression compared to the HG group.In terms of ferroptosis,the protein and mRNA expression of SLC7A11 and GPX4 significantly decreased,the expression of TFR-1 and AC-SL4 significantly increased,and the fluorescence intensity of ROS was significantly enhanced in the HG group com-pared with the control group.Inhibition of ferroptosis in the HG+Fer-1 group resulted in significant changes in fer-roptosis and ECM synthesis-related indicators expression levels compared to the HG group.Furthermore,re-expres-sion of miR-26a in the HG+miR-26a led to significant changes in ferroptosis-related indicators expression levels and decreased ROS fluorescence intensity compared to the HG group.Conclusions In HG-induced RTECs,miR-26a inhibits the occurrence of ferroptosis,thus reducing ECM synthesis.
9.Clinical characteristics of children patients with carbapenem resistant Klebsiella pneumoniae infection and risk factors for poor prognosis
Chunyun FU ; Huan ZHANG ; Minxue LIU ; Zhenjiao CEN ; Jialing RUAN ; Shuangjie WANG ; Xuehua HU
Chongqing Medicine 2024;53(2):198-203
Objective To analyze the clinical characteristics,drug resistance and risk factors for poor prognosis in children patients with carbapenem resistant Klebsiella pneumoniae(CRKP)infection.Methods The samples of CRKP isolated from the children inpatients in this hospital from August 5,2016 to December 31,2020 were collected.The clinical data and drug resistance of CRKP in the patients with CRKP positive were analyzed.The risk factors in the poor prognosis group and good prognosis group of children pa-tients with CRKP infection conducted the correlation analysis.Results A total of 106 strains of non-repeti-tive CRKP were collected,which were mainly isolated from the patients ≤ 1 year old.The department distri-bution was dominated by the neonatal ICU and comprehensive ICU.CRKP showed the high resistance to mul-tiple antibacterial drugs,and its resistance rates to amikacin,levofloxacin,gentamicin,ciprofloxacin,minocy-cline and chloramphenicol were less than 30%.The poor prognosis rate in the children patients with CRKP in-fection reached 27.4%.The logistic multivariate regression analysis results showed that the multiple organ dysfunction and anemia were the independent risk factors for poor prognosis in the children patients with CRKP infection(P<0.05).Conclusion The children CRKP infection is mainly the infants ≤1 years old,and CRKP shows the high resistance to multiple antibacterial drugs,the independent risk factors of poor prognosis include the multiple organ dysfunction and anemia
10.Effects of plateau environment on tear indexes and related anatomical structures of rabbits
Jinmei QIAN ; Bin HU ; Feie ZHANG ; Qi YANG ; Wenxue ZHU ; Jialing ZHANG ; Yan CAI
International Eye Science 2024;24(4):515-521
AIM: To investigate the effects of hypobaric hypoxia in plateau on tear indexes and related anatomical structures in rabbits.METHODS: A total of 18 healthy New Zealand rabbits were selected and randomly divided into plateau group and control group, with 9 rabbits(18 eyes)in each group. The plateau group was housed in the Simulated Climate Cabin for Special Environment of Northwest of China, simulating hypobaric hypoxia at an altitude of 6 000 m. The control group was housed in a clean animal room with atmospheric pressure and oxygen. Changes in the tear meniscus height and non-invasive tear break-up time were detected by using RHCT-1 corneal topographer dry eye comprehensive analysis system, changes in tear secretion was measured by Schirmer Ⅰ test, before intervention and on the 3, 7 d, 2 and 4 wk. Meanwhile, the changes in tear composition before and after intervention in the plateau environment were analyzed using Raman Spectroscopy. The histopathological changes of the lower lid conjunctiva, cornea, lacrimal gland, and Hardarian gland were observed by hematoxylin-eosin(HE)staining after 4 wk of intervention, and the expression of mucin 5AC(MUC5AC)in conjunctiva was detected by immunohistochemistry.RESULTS: Compared with the control group, Schirmer Ⅰ test, tear meniscus height, first and average non-invasive tear break-up time in the plateau group decreased significantly since 3 d, and the difference was significant with the extension of observation time(P<0.05). The above indexes increased from 2 wk. After 4 wk of intervention, the protein and lipid content of the tear composition of rabbits in the plateau group increased, and the nucleic acid content decreased compared with the pre-intervention period. Compared with the control group, rabbits in the plateau group showed thickening of corneal stromal edema, an increase in the number of conjunctival cup cells, increase in the level of expression of MUC5AC, an increase in the level of expression of MUC5AC, an atrophy and flattening of cytoplasm in lacrimal epithelial cells, an enlargement of glandular lumen, and no obvious destructive changes in the Hardarian glands.CONCLUSION: Acute plateau environment can destroy the homeostasis of rabbit ocular surface, so that the tear secretion and the tear film stability decreases, but within a certain period of time, rabbits undergo compensation with the habituation to the hypobaric hypoxia environment, which can increase the tear secretion to a certain extent and restore the tear film stability.
